Publisher's Synopsis
Selected Topics in Prenatal and Neonatal Diagnoses explores the latest prenatal and neonatal diagnostics advancements, offering clinicians, researchers, and healthcare professionals a comprehensive resource on emerging technologies and methodologies. This volume covers key developments in fetal imaging, genetic screening, and early neurorehabilitation, highlighting the critical role of early detection and intervention in improving neonatal outcomes. With a focus on ultrasound innovations, next-generation sequencing, and neuroplasticity-based rehabilitation, this book bridges the gap between cutting-edge research and clinical practice. Readers will gain valuable insights into non-invasive diagnostic techniques, genetic advancements in rare metabolic disorders, and novel strategies for managing perinatal brain injuries. By presenting a multidisciplinary approach to prenatal and neonatal care, this volume is an essential reference for those dedicated to optimizing maternal-fetal health and shaping the future of neonatal medicine.
